JUSTUS LAWRENCE at GOLDEN GATE NATIONALS APRIL 2008
This is one of Justus's fight at the Golden Gate Nationals in San Francisco. It is one of my favorites every year! Some of the best fighters in the nation come to compete and it is so cool to watch. We were lucky enough to watch Justus's uncle Mark and his brother Dallas compete also.
Justus took:
1st place - Traditional Forms
1st place - Light Middle Sparring
1st place - Continuous Sparring
2nd place - Team Sparring
and something really exciting
Overall Grand Champion in Sparring
(this is when all the winners of the separate sparring divisions from feather weight to Super Heavy and in between, compete until there is one man left standing).

JUSTUS COMPETE NATIONALS 2008
Many of you haven't had a chance to see Justus compete on a National or International level, so we thought it would be fun to start sharing some of his fights and footage here.
He went the Compete Nationals tournament in Ontario, California. He took:
1st in Light Weight Continuous Sparring and
1st in Sparring
During the runoffs he received an injury that threw him out for overall finals. But all in all, Justus had a good time and felt great about being able to compete.
